He landed a sinecure as a consultant for the company.
他得到了公司顧問的閒職。
The position was seen as a sinecure with little actual work involved.
這個職位被視爲一種無需實際工作的閒職。
She was given a sinecure in the marketing department.
她在市場部門得到了一個閒職。
The sinecure allowed him plenty of time to pursue his hobbies.
這個閒職讓他有足夠的時間追求自己的愛好。
The sinecure came with a generous salary and benefits.
這個閒職帶來了豐厚的薪水和福利。
The sinecure was offered to him as a favor from a friend.
這個閒職是他的朋友的一種恩惠。
She accepted the sinecure knowing it would be an easy job.
她接受了這個閒職,知道這將是一份輕鬆的工作。
The sinecure was created specifically for him due to his connections.
這個閒職是因爲他的關係而專門爲他設立的。
He treated the sinecure as a stepping stone to a more challenging role.
他把這個閒職當作通往更具挑戰性角色的墊腳石。
The sinecure allowed her to maintain a work-life balance.
這個閒職讓她能夠保持工作與生活的平衡。
